Output 87f45cb407133f23ada7b3ba78c1d3133e5945d1aa592d2b419789d1ac3ca369:0

value
56631176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8568e66a411b427a9fc3f92410cfb29ac1d0231 OP_EQUAL
address
3QL7C9kMjTGktuLY2EFdzeDRXQR993haqw
transaction
87f45cb407133f23ada7b3ba78c1d3133e5945d1aa592d2b419789d1ac3ca369
spent
true